Fiberglass

Fiberglass windows and doors are made by a process called pultrusion. This automated process involves pultrusion, which is the process of pulling lengths of fiberglass strand mat or roving through heated dies. The material is formed into long rods and long strips known as "lineals". Lineals are then screwed using hidden corner blocks reinforced by nylon to create strong, tight joints. The doors and windows are finished with an exterior and interior coating to ensure durability beauty, weather resistance and beauty.

These windows are a good choice for homeowners looking to enhance the appearance of their home with an energy-efficient upgrade. They are available in a range of finishes and colors and are easy-to-maintain. They're also resistant to rot, mold and swelling. The composite material used in the production of the windows and doors provides high strength and low moisture absorption. It also withstands temperature fluctuations.

Double-pane windows are made up of two panes of insulated glass which are sealed as a complete unit. These windows are very popular with homeowners who want to lower energy costs, insulate from extreme temperatures, noise and other environmental elements. The space between the glass is filled with either the gas argon or Krypton which creates an air barrier and blocks heat transfer. In addition to the kind of glass the frame material and design can also influence the windows overall energy use and labeling.

There are a variety of options to replace double-paned windows. You can replace the entire frame or just the IGU panel within the frame. The latter option can be less expensive, however it might not offer the same level of energy efficiency as a completely new window.
